Idaho H 360 (2018) — ASSAULT AND BATTERY – Amends existing law to revise a provision regarding counseling, to provide that the supreme court shall establish a certain rule and to provide that a person guilty of attempted strangulation shall undergo a certain evaluation, counseling and other treatment.

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- 2018-01-16 Introduced, read first time, referred to JRA for Printing
introduction - 2018-01-17 Reported Printed and Referred to Judiciary, Rules & Administration
- 2018-01-24 Reported out of Committee with Do Pass Recommendation, Filed for Second Reading
committee-passage-favorable - 2018-01-25 Read second time; Filed for Third Reading

reading-3, passage - 2018-01-30 Received from the House passed; filed for first reading
- 2018-01-30 Introduced, read first time; referred to: Judiciary & Rules
introduction - 2018-02-28 Reported out of Committee with Do Pass Recommendation; Filed for second reading
committee-passage-favorable - 2018-03-01 Read second time; filed for Third Reading

reading-3, passage - 2018-03-08 Returned from Senate Passed; to JRA for Enrolling
- 2018-03-09 Reported Enrolled; Signed by Speaker; Transmitted to Senate
- 2018-03-12 Received from the House enrolled/signed by Speaker
- 2018-03-12 Signed by President; returned to House
- 2018-03-13 Returned Signed by the President; Ordered Transmitted to Governor
- 2018-03-14 Delivered to Governor at 11:20 a.m. on March 13, 2018
- 2018-03-19 Reported Signed by Governor on March 19, 2018 Session Law Chapter 123 Effective: 07/01/2018
